Materials Needed

  • Rubbing alcohol
  • Cotton swab or cloth
  • Washcloth
  • Laundry detergent

Removing the Stain

  1. Blot stain with a clean cotton swab or cloth soaked in rubbing alcohol.
  2. Gently rub the swab over the stain. Try not to rub too hard, as this may cause the sap to spread.
  3. Once the sap is removed, rinse the area with cold water.
  4. If the stain is still present, apply laundry detergent directly to it.
  5. Leave detergent on for a few minutes before rinsing with a washcloth.
  6. Repeat steps 1-4 until the stain is completely gone.
